The two failure points in roofing are volume and weather, and they arrive together. In the 72 hours after a hailstorm the company that books the inspection first usually gets the job, and the company still working through voicemail on day three does not. Then the follow-on rain wipes out a Tuesday and someone spends the morning on forty calls. This agent answers during the surge and rebuilds the washed-out day in one operation, which is the difference between a storm being a good month and a chaotic one.
A simple, three-step flow.
The agent takes the request, asks what the homeowner is seeing, how old the roof is and whether a claim has been filed, then records the address.
It offers windows that sit inside an existing neighborhood cluster, avoiding days the forecast marks as unworkable for roof access.
If the forecast turns, the agent moves the affected appointments to the next workable day and texts each homeowner the new window.
A realistic use case with concrete timing and output.
Scenario: a roofing company with three inspectors normally books 25 inspections a week. Hail passes on a Sunday evening. By Monday lunchtime 180 requests have come in. The agent answers all of them, captures what each homeowner is seeing and whether they have filed a claim, and books into six neighborhood clusters rather than in call order — one inspector covers 14 roofs on Wednesday within a two-mile radius instead of 8 spread across the county. Thursday's forecast turns to steady rain by Tuesday night. The agent moves Thursday's 16 appointments to Saturday and Monday, texts every homeowner the new window before 7am, and offers the four who cannot make it a choice of two alternatives. Nobody in the office made a call.
